Importance of Earplug Material and Construction

The material and construction of earplugs play a significant role in durability and noise reduction. Riders should opt for earplugs made from materials that are comfortable, easy to clean, and resistant to damage.

  • Custom-molded earplugs offer excellent noise reduction and a comfortable fit.
  • Silicone earplugs are soft, flexible, and easy to clean but may not be as effective in terms of noise reduction.
  • Foam earplugs are disposable and relatively inexpensive, but they may not be as durable or comfortable as other options.

In terms of construction, riders should look for earplugs with a secure and airtight design to prevent sound from leaking in. Additionally, riders should consider earplugs with a breathable design to prevent moisture buildup and discomfort.

Impact of Earplugs on Sound Quality and Safety

Earplugs designed for loud noises can affect sound quality by reducing the overall level of noise, including music, traffic sounds, and engine roar. While they can help prevent hearing loss, some earplugs can also alter the tone and frequencies of the sound, making it less pleasant for the rider. To minimize these effects, look for earplugs with flat frequency response, which preserves the natural sound quality. Additionally, consider earplugs with a sound-filtering design, which can reduce the noise level while maintaining the clarity of the sound.

When choosing earplugs, consider the noise reduction rating (NRR), which measures the earplug’s ability to reduce noise levels. A higher NRR rating indicates greater noise reduction, but it may also affect sound quality.

Custom-Molded Earplugs for Motorcycle Riders

Custom-molded earplugs offer a personalized solution for motorcycle riders with sensitive ears, providing a snug fit and optimal noise reduction. These earplugs are created using a mold of the rider’s ear, ensuring a precise fit that blocks out excess noise while still allowing for clear communication.
For riders who require a tailored solution, custom-molded earplugs can be a game-changer, offering superior noise reduction and comfort. By catering to the unique shape and dimensions of each rider’s ear, these earplugs provide a level of customization that stock earplugs simply cannot match.

Obtaining Custom-Molded Earplugs

To obtain custom-molded earplugs, riders typically undergo a simple process involving the creation of a mold of their ear. This is usually done by a professional audiologist or a specialized earplug manufacturer. The mold is then used to create a custom earplug that is tailored to the rider’s specific needs.

  • The process begins with a consultation with a professional to assess the rider’s ear shape, size, and noise-reduction requirements.
  • The audiologist will take an impression of the rider’s ear using a moldable material.
  • The impression is then sent to a laboratory for creation of the custom earplug.
  • The custom earplug is manufactured using advanced materials and technologies to ensure optimal noise reduction and comfort.
